L.S.Ltoconoma

A track that makes you want to close your eyes and listen quietly at night.
It’s a song by toconoma, an instrumental band formed in 2008.
It’s included on their third album, NEWTOWN, released in 2017.
Stylish sounds that make your ears happy.
Amber-Hued City, Morning of Shanghai Crabskururi

Quruli is a Kyoto-based band whose varied musical styles can be enjoyed from album to album.
This song is the lead track from their 2016 EP “Amber-Colored Town, Morning of the Shanghai Crab.” Its laid-back groove and hip-hop-flavored vocals are striking.

White WindMomoiro Kurōbā Zetto

With their fiery live performances and each member’s distinctive personality, the music group Momoiro Clover Z is hugely popular.
“Shiroi Kaze” is a song released in 2011.
It’s a positive song that sings about a future moving forward together with someone important.
Drifting emotionsKotoringo

This is a song by Kotringo, a musician from Osaka Prefecture.
It’s included on her 2017 album “Ame no Hakoniwa” (Rain’s Miniature Garden).
Her gentle singing voice and softly resonant piano tones soothe a tired heart.
The song was used as the theme for the drama “100 Manen no Onna-tachi” (Million Yen Women).
OdysseyZa Natsuyasumi Bando

Formed in 2008, The Natsuyasumi Band is a four-piece group.
This song is included on their third album, PHANTASIA, released in 2016.
It’s a love song that sings of bittersweet feelings.
The music video, with its beautiful visual effects, is also a must-see.
